I got this in a Woot deal before, it is still used daily at work, but I wish I had a different one. I look forward to replacing it.
-The buttons have an annoying metallic click sound
-The programmed buttons forget what they are supposed to do and sometimes do not perform their duties. The only way to make them work again is to reboot
The batteries do last a long time, though, easily 3-4 months each.
